&lt;p&gt;&lt;img style="float: right; margin-left: 10px;" alt="a-fork-in-the-road2" height="375" width="250" src="http://www.coastalfitness.ca/images/stories/a-fork-in-the-road2.jpg"&gt;&lt;span style="color: #000000;"&gt;Why is this applicable to fitness, health and nutrition?&amp;nbsp; The premise is simple; someone has made it to&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="color: #000000;"&gt;where you want to go.&amp;nbsp; So why not follow the path?&amp;nbsp; We set goals a month ago to ‘be more active’, ‘lose 10 lbs’, get stronger... etc. Well, a number of weeks have passed and personal willpower is waning and now you have a choice.&amp;nbsp; Justify your jumping off the bandwagon or find the successful path to the other side.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style="color: #000000;"&gt;I reflect on my early twenties as a period of time where all of a sudden my parents became magically wise again.&amp;nbsp; As it turns out, I am not the only one to have experienced this phenomenon.&amp;nbsp; While I scrambled to glean as much info as I could from my newly discovered fount of knowledge, I quickly realized that there were many other areas of life that I was headed towards that others in my circle had traveled before and were successful.&amp;nbsp; Now, I understand general self help books and solution based information is abound in print, on the internet and via seminars.&amp;nbsp; While all are good and I frequently read and attend, what I have found most beneficial is to ask questions of someone who is already in my circle and knows me.&amp;nbsp; One of my favourite questions over coffee usually is “&lt;i&gt;tell me something in 10 minutes that took you 10 years to learn&lt;/i&gt;.”&amp;nbsp; This usually gives me enough time to harvest one golden nugget from that person’s experience that I can apply and avoid a pitfall myself.&amp;nbsp; What I have found particularly interesting, is the fact that because the person you are speaking to knows you, they either subconsciously or consciously, (doesn’t matter to me) gear the knowledge bomb to something that is applicable to you.&amp;nbsp; So great!&amp;nbsp; Using this method I have in mere hours gained &lt;b&gt;&lt;i&gt;personal&lt;/i&gt;&lt;/b&gt; insight into things that would have taken me years to solve on my own or even read about from general sources.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

			<description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style="color: #000000;"&gt;&lt;img style="margin: 2px; float: right;" alt="knee_pain" src="http://www.coastalfitness.ca/images/stories/knee_pain.jpg" width="200" height="369" /&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 12pt;"&gt;We recently finished a talk with a group of runners training for the &lt;a href="http://www.runforwater.ca/index.html"&gt;Run for Water&lt;/a&gt; at &lt;a href="http://abbyrunner.wordpress.com/"&gt;Peninsula Runners in Abbotsford&lt;/a&gt;.&amp;nbsp; This is a summary of what we spoke about.&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style="color: #000000;"&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 12pt;"&gt;It&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="font-size: 12pt;"&gt; is well documented that one of the most common areas of injury in  runners is the knee joint.&amp;nbsp; One of the main reasons for this is the lack  of balance in the muscles that stabilize the knee.&amp;nbsp; For most runners  they have strong/tight quadriceps and weak posterior chain muscles  (hamstrings &amp;amp; glutes).&amp;nbsp; These imbalances lead to knee problems.&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;  Using some simple exercises can help START you on the path correcting  these imbalances.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;img src="http://feeds.feedburner.com/~r/CoastalConnection/~4/AR9dZgBmI1E" height="1" width="1"/&gt;</description>
